COVID-19对严重不受控制的喘成本和生物使用的影响

由于COVID-19大流行,严重失控喘 (SUA) 患者的医疗保健费用降低,但处方费用增加. 在此期间,生物治疗的使用也显著下降.

背景情况:
- 严重不受控制的喘 (SUA) 造成了严重的经济负担,往往需要生物治疗.
- COVID-19大流行对喘相关成本和生物利用的影响尚未评估.
研究的目的:
- 调查假设在COVID-19大流行期间,严重不受控制的喘的成本和生物使用量下降.
主要方法:
- 从2017年1月到2021年12月,分析了严重不受控制的喘患者的医疗成本和生物使用情况.
- 利用来自大型管理护理组织的索赔数据和来自罗伯特·伍德·约翰逊·巴拿巴健康的电子健康记录.
- 数据按提供者专业 (初级保健医生和专家) 分层.
主要成果:
- 在所有护理群体中,严重不受控制的喘患者的总医疗费用在疫情期间下降了 (34%-45%的减少).
- 住院和门诊费用下降,处方费用增加.
- 生物使用量在流行前一直在增加,但在流行前减少了两倍,并且仍然很低.
结论:
- 随着COVID-19大流行,住院和门诊的费用降低,但严重的非控制性喘患者的处方费用增加.
- 在严重不受控制的喘患者中,生物利用在疫情期间显著下降,并保持低.
